How To Choose The Right Old School Tattoo Flash
Choosing the perfect tattoo design can be overwhelming, especially with the rich variety available. Here are some key points to consider when selecting your traditional old school tattoo flash:
1. Personal Meaning: Consider what the design means to you. Tattoos often serve as markers of important experiences or beliefs. If a symbol resonates with your life story, it will hold more significance.
2. Style and Aesthetic: Traditional tattoos have a distinct look characterized by bold lines and vibrant colors. Think about whether this style matches your overall aesthetic and lifestyle.
3. Size and Placement: Where do you envision the tattoo? The size and location can greatly influence the design. Larger tattoos may allow for more detail, while smaller ones should be simpler.
4. Artist Expertise: Not all tattoo artists specialize in traditional styles. Research artists in your area known for old school ink and check their portfolios to ensure they can bring your vision to life.
5. Longevity: Traditional tattoos are designed to last. Choose a design that you believe will still hold meaning for you in the years to come, avoiding trends that may fade over time.

How To Care For Your Traditional Tattoo
Caring for your new tattoo is essential for ensuring it heals properly and maintains its vibrant look. Here’s how to care for your traditional old school ink:
Tools You’ll Need:
– Antibacterial soap
– Fragrance-free moisturizer
– Non-stick bandage or plastic wrap
Step 1: Cleanse the Tattoo
✔ Gently wash the tattoo with lukewarm water and antibacterial soap.
✔ Do this at least twice a day for the first week.
Step 2: Moisturize
✔ After washing, apply a thin layer of fragrance-free moisturizer to keep the tattoo hydrated.
✔ Avoid heavy creams that may clog pores.
Step 3: Protect the Tattoo
✔ For the first few days, consider covering the tattoo with a non-stick bandage to protect it from dirt and friction.
✔ Change the bandage regularly to maintain cleanliness.
Step 4: Avoid Sun Exposure
✔ Keep your tattoo out of direct sunlight during the healing process to prevent fading.
✔ Once healed, always apply sunscreen on your tattoo when exposed to the sun.
Step 5: Watch for Signs of Infection
✔ Be vigilant for redness, swelling, or unusual discharge. If you notice these signs, consult a healthcare professional.
⏱ Time: ~2-3 weeks for full healing | 💡 Tip: Be patient and avoid picking at scabs to prevent scarring!
1. The Classic Anchor
The anchor tattoo is a cornerstone of traditional design, symbolizing strength and unwavering hope. Frequently linked to sailors, this design captures the essence of stability, making it a beloved choice for many. Its adaptability allows it to fit various styles—whether you prefer a sleek minimalist version or something more intricate that tells a story.
Adding floral elements can soften the anchor, making it more appealing to a feminine aesthetic.
Incorporating initials or meaningful dates into the banner creates a personal touch.
Ideal placements include the forearm, chest, or behind the ear, each offering a unique visibility level.
This classic design resonates with those who honor their roots while staying open to life’s adventures.

6. Swallow Tattoos: Symbol of Return
Swallows are deeply connected to sailors, symbolizing safe returns home. This delicate bird tattoo captures freedom and the journey of life, making it a meaningful choice. With graceful lines and vibrant colors, the swallow is a classic option for anyone seeking a design that balances beauty and significance.
Choosing to have one swallow can carry personal meaning, while two can symbolize love and companionship.
Pairing swallows with anchors or banners adds depth to the design, enhancing its story.
Ideal placements include the wrist, collarbone, or back, highlighting their delicate features beautifully.
This timeless symbol connects us to the essence of home and adventure, making it a cherished design choice.

Frequently Asked Questions
What defines traditional old school tattoo flash and why is it timeless?
Traditional old school tattoo flash is defined by bold black outlines, a limited color palette, and iconic sailor and nautical motifs. This approach remains timeless because simple, strong imagery reads clearly on skin and ages gracefully. Look at a sheet labeled ‘traditional old school tattoo flash’ and you’ll see anchors, ships, swallows, hearts, and roses rendered with confident lines.
Practical tips: start with a single bold motif in solid black; limit colors to 2–4 hues plus black and white; keep shading flat for longevity. If you’re creating your own designs, study classic flash art sheets and borrow composition ideas while staying true to traditional tattoo motifs.
Which traditional tattoo motifs are most popular for sailor and nautical themes?
Anchors, ships, swallows, compasses, and roses are classic traditional tattoo motifs that scream sailor and nautical vibes. Swallows symbolize safe travels, anchors denote stability, ships tell stories of journeys, and compasses point the way home. For old school ink, keep bold outlines and limited shading; place a single focal piece on the forearm or bicep, or build a mini-sleeve by combining motifs around an anchor for a cohesive look in retro tattoo styles.
How can I mix vintage tattoo designs with modern tattoo preferences without losing the old school vibe?
To blend vintage tattoos with modern tastes while keeping the old school vibe, preserve the core cues: bold outlines, minimal shading, and a restricted color palette. Use classic flash art as your skeleton, then add contemporary touches like micro tattoos or softer shading around edges. For sailor/nautical themes, keep anchors and ships but simplify details so the design remains readable at smaller sizes. Always check line weight and placement, and work with an artist who specializes in traditional old school tattoo flash to adapt it well. Practical steps: pick a focal motif, scale it, retain heavy black outlines, limit colors to 3–4 shades, and test on paper before inking.

What aftercare helps traditional old school tattoos stay bold over time?
To keep traditional old school tattoos looking sharp, follow solid aftercare: clean gently, moisturize with fragrance-free products, and protect the area from the sun with high-SPF sunscreen after healing. Bold lines in old school ink tend to age well, but avoid aggressive rubbing and give your tattoo time to heal fully. Long-term care includes occasional touch-ups for colors like red and yellow that tend to fade, plus consistent sun protection to preserve contrast. By treating it with care, your traditional tattoo motifs will stay vibrant for years.
